Need help with setup of working Q jet
raguza123:
I finally got her to idle off high idle, I found the throttle shafts were binding so I cleaned them and oiled them, now they close with the Accel pump spring.
I had the idle mixtures set to 5 turns out and was told that is too much.
It's on top of a Pontiac 326, slightly modified from stock. It's an 1980 q jet off a olds 307/350 engines, it has 39 Primary rods, 68 Jets and CV secondary rods, all the air bleeds were changed out and idle tubes too.
I turned the mixtures all the way in and it was still idling, slight change, I set them to 4 turns out.
It is idling with a slight miss and smells rich my eyes burn, I also hit the secondary upper plate open by accident and it stalled.
OK What am I doing wrong here?
I did not use a vac. gauge to set idle mixtures.
I am using full manifold vac. on the vac. adv. and timing is set to factory specs 6* BTC
The APT is set to 3 turns up.
Float is set to 5/16"
Cliff Ruggles:
5/16" is pretty low for the float setting, move it up to 9/32-1/4" instead.
If you see any change moving the secondary airflaps, the huge secondary throttle plates aren't fully closed at idle..IE...vacuum leak....Cliff
